首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

富媒体在客服IM消息通信中的秒实践

跟普通的文本传输相比,富媒体可以直观的让用户了解到消息内容,但是在传输过程中也面临着文件大、内存消耗大、传输过程漫长等问题。...二、面临的挑战 客服发送大文件(视频、图片)等消息给用户的大致流程如下: 首先通过文件上传服务上传到CDN,同时返回对应的CDN地址链接; 其次是获取到CDN地址链接,通过IM网关链接返回给用户界面渲染...比较理想的方式是当客服发送文件的时候,文件立马在聊天窗口渲染,此时渲染的不是完整的文件,而是文件的画像,比如文件的名字、封面图片,通过消息的状态进行上传状态的控制。...三、解决方案与成效 1、fileReader.target.result作为视频的url在页面渲染 最初使用的方式是在视频上传CDN时,同时截取视频首帧,然后截取的视频首帧也上传到CDN,再通过长链...采用的URL.createObjectURL(file) 获取到URL(这个URL对象表示指定的 File 对象或 Blob 对象),然后放到聊天数据的缓存中,便于快速发送到客服聊天窗口页面。

1.5K61
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    如何消息指定时间发送到钉钉群里

    如何消息指定时间发送到钉钉群里 目录 1、前言 2、添加机器人 3、编写脚本 4、Jenkins配置 5、消息通知效果 1、前言 根据项目组需求,组员每天都要写工作日报,但有时候忙起来,就忘记写日报这个事了...如图所示: 除了可以用群助手,也可以自定义消息来完成消息通知。 方法其实类似 爬取蒲公英内测版信息推送到钉钉群 这篇文章。...pip3 install requests 发送消息有两种格式: 1、消息格式为:text #!...print(res.text) if __name__=="__main__": test_markdown() 4、Jenkins配置 1、创建日报通知项目,脚本可以上传到Git上来进行获取或者脚本上传到本地服务器来进行获取...5、消息通知效果 1、控制台查看Jenkins构建日志。 2、钉钉群收到的消息消息格式为:text。 3、钉钉群收到的消息消息格式为:markdown。

    2.7K10

    Q&A丨即时通信 IM 技术问答第一期强势来袭

    场景:APP端有N个房产经纪人,用户关注微信公众号后,通过我们嵌入公众号的H5页面,选择一名房产经纪人通过微信聊天给这名经纪人发送咨询消息。...消息通过微信公众号接口发送到腾讯 IM 后,再匹配到对应的经纪人,经纪人收到用户咨询后通过APP端给用户回复消息。...A IM 消息抄送到业务侧服务器,业务侧服务器消息通过客服接口消息推送至微信客服,微信客服返回消息到业务后台后,业务后台通过 REST API 发送给指定接收人。...用户通过控制台也可实现简单的数据管理、单/群发消息,开发者可以在控制台进行简单的数据管理、查看及测试。相比之下,REST API 接口较为原始,但管理能力却更为强大。...Q4 云直播SDK怎么使用通信IM的功能? A 如果希望在云直播中实现弹幕消息、点赞、送礼等消息类型,需要接入即时通信IM产品sdk。 Q5 即时通信IM可以直接做音视频通话吗?

    85510

    企点客服V3.8 | 23个能力上新,实现服务营销一体化新升级

    「客户创建工单」,创建后的工单可以直接按照小组来分配,业务跨部门流转更高效 智能客服人性化交互:在线机器人不仅可以看懂你的文字消息,也能听懂你说的语音,还能根据企业不同风格智能互动寒暄。...企点客服可以对客户的访问来源信息、会话行为和客户属性设置自动化评分规则,高价值客户一目了然,提升客户的服务体验,后续还能针对相应客群进行营销活动的精准消息发送,提升复购。...同一客户身份识别 ▶不同来访渠道,怎么识别同一客户? 企点客服3.8支持微信生态的用户画像统一,客户无论是通过企业的哪一个公众号,还是小程序进行咨询,都能自动识别为同一自然人,统一用户的标签资料。...智能工单升级服务 客户留言创建工单 ▶客服下班时,怎么响应客户咨询? 企点客服3.8支持客服人员在无法及时接待时,引导客户填写工单,便于后续跟进客户需求。...欢迎小伙伴们移步官网 下载新版本体验~ 如果您对我们的产品感兴趣 可点击阅读原文,留下您的信息 我们安排专业的售前专家与您取得联系 ● 一图看懂腾讯企点客服 ● 最佳实践 | 3个服务营销实例,教你轻松实现

    1.1K20

    WebSocket开发(客服对话)功能

    区分角色:在连接建立时区分用户跟客服的客户端角色 客服角色客户端id固定 用户角色客户端id可变 连接指定:客户端无需选择指定客户端,系统自动匹配客服客户端 一对多:一个客服是对应多个用户的 双向绑定...连接指定 之前假设用户是在页面上进行指定客户端进行一对一通讯,在客服场景下用户肯定不能输入客服的客户端编号进行通讯吧,那体验可想而知,所以需要判断如果是用户客户端发送的消息就匹配在线的客服消息推送过去...客服客户端: 在客服客服端这里也可以得到发送人的客户端ID,通过输入接收人返回消息,这样双端可以开始通讯 2.3.2 多客服端分配 如果是随机分配客服Map的获取操作搞成随机的即可,如下示例...在上面给出了两个解决方案 一个客户端只跟一个客服聊天 消息记录跟客服端不绑定 第一个一个客户端只跟一个客服聊天就跟是本节的一个思路,双向绑定,当一个客户端与一个客服端发送消息后尽量消息发送给此客服端。...:消息补偿看看 5.2.1 页面验证 用户端: 客服端: 5.2.2 日志验证 从日志上可以看到,客户端一条消息的同时会将之前的消息也补偿同步上。

    1K31

    小程序社区经典问题集锦(上)

    6、客服消息历史记录怎么保存、查看?...如果想保存客服消息历史记录,可以自己接管客服消息,官方文档:https://developers.weixin.qq.com/miniprogram/dev/framework/server-ability...9、已封禁二维码能力至永久,该怎么办? 相信大家在做小程序过程中,多少都遇到过被封禁的情况。模板消息、复制功能、分享功能、二维码识别能力等,轻微的封禁1天、3天,较严重的,会被封禁至永久。...10、小程序服务通知 在小程序里,说到服务通知,首先想到的是模板消息。但是,模板消息也是投诉的重灾区,这里不细说。还有另一个问题,模板消息有数量限制,单日100W条。 超出100W条该怎么办?...也可以引导用户关注公众号,用公众号通知。已经有很多家小程序这样做了,这里我就不列举~ 讨论题: 大家是如何在小程序内,引导用户关注公众号的?

    90630

    移动网络骗局典型案例—-防骗指南

    赵先生按照“客服”要求,在支付宝首页输入“招”字,搜索的第一个结果点进去操作后,赵先生的账户上多了17000元,之后,赵先生扫描了“客服”发送的二维码,17000元转账给了“客服”。...自从2016年下半年开始,退款诈骗利用互联网贷款业务进行行骗已经变为诈骗的新方式,这类骗局最大的特点就是利用受害者不了解最新的互联网贷款业务(只要经过平台设置的身份验证,即可在几分钟内小额款项打入借款人指定的账号...小曾心动后主动添加了对方QQ,与客服沟通过工作内容后,客服要求用户支付宝付款条形码下面的数字发送给他,完成任务后提供佣金;于是小曾按照要求支付宝中付款码的数字28094261411505371送给了对方...首先,点击链接,关注公众号以后,你会收到自动推送消息,引导你联系客服进行清理。 添加人工客服后,对方会对清理步骤做简单介绍或发送教程视频,查看步骤后,需要回复确认是否清理。...被“中奖”冲昏头脑的绣绣赶紧联系对方问怎么领取手机,对方说手机是免费的,但是手机要从中国香港总公司发货,需要支付69元保价费。

    2.3K80

    微信公众平台多客服新增自定义客服头像和消息转发接口功能

    客服一般是开放给微信认证服务号的一个便捷功能,可以消息转发到多客服方便回复。对有些“选择综合症“的客服,看到那一层不变的客服头像就想吐槽。...二、为满足公众号个性化客服需求,公众平台为开发者提供了“多客服”相关接口,可将消息转发到多客服消息转发到指定客服。   ...A:如果公众号处于开发模式,普通微信用户向公众号发消息时,微信服务器会先将消息POST到开发者填写的url上,如果希望消息转发到多客服系统,则需要开发者在响应包中返回MsgType为transfer_customer_service...[CDATA[transfer_customer_service]]>   B:如果您希望某个客户的消息转给指定客服来接待,可以在返回transfer_customer_service...消息时附上TransInfo信息指定 一个客服帐号。

    2.8K40

    见了这么多萌萌哒的小妹妹之后,我终于忍不住了...

    照片给我的,有语音给我的,有早晨好的,有… 骂街的… 到底我的公众号为何忽然如此有魅力呢?是因为我帅吗?是因为我的才华吗?是因为我有钱吗?...蜀黍又不会讲故事,蜀黍又不能陪你玩,蜀黍连文章都不敢发了~ 另外,小程序提供的客服入口,必须要登录电脑版的客服平台才能接入并回复消息,这个流程对于没有专职客服的小程序来说,门槛就有点高了。...而考虑用客服消息接口开发集中客服管理平台,一来需要开发资源,二来除了接入自动回复甚至 AI 机器人之外,还是要有专职客服才可以,对个人开发者就不够友好。...其实对于个人开发者,如能打通客服消息和绑定的微信开发者之间的消息,会方便很多。即:普通的个人小程序,只需要把自己的微信号绑定为唯一的客服即可。如果有人咨询问题,直接当聊天回复即可。...但是对于愿意既当开发又当客服的,这个功能就很方便了,你们觉得呢?

    58350

    客服功能终于也向所有微信认证的订阅号开放了

    认证公众号的开发者可使用多客服相关接口,完成定制化客服功能开发 消息转发到多客服 如果公众号处于开发模式,普通微信用户向公众号发消息时,微信服务器会先将消息POST到开发者填写的url上,如果希望消息转发到多客服系统...(整型) MsgType 是 transfer_customer_service 消息转发到指定客服 如果您有多个客服人员同时登陆了多客服并且开启了自动接入在进行接待,每一个客户的消息转发给多客服时...如果您希望某个客户的消息转给指定客服来接待,可以在返回transfer_customer_service消息时附上TransInfo信息 指定一个客服帐号。...需要注意,如果指定客服没有接入能力(不在线、没有开启自动接入或者自动接入已满),该用户会一直等待指定客服有接入能力后才会被接入,而不会被其他客 服接待。...建议在指定客服时,先查询客服的接入能力(获取在线客服接待信息接口),指定到有能力接入的客服,保证客户能够及时得到服务。 示例代码 <!

    1.5K60

    微信二次开发SDK:可群控营销手机,智能回复等功能

    微信群管理功能API 1、入群欢迎语 2、指定群管理员 3、群管理统计(活跃度、发言数、总人数、邀请数、退出数等) 4、群管理员踢人 5、群关键词回复,群智能客服 6、建群、拉人功能接口 ...上述这些...微信营销功能API 1、朋友圈(图文、链接、长短视频) 2、发长视频到微信朋友圈 3、朋友圈点赞,按比例点赞,按数量点赞 4、漂流瓶信息 5、智能自动回复 6、同步指定微信好友朋友圈 ...这些API...微信聊天对话功能API 1、微信上线通知 2、微信下线通知 3、微信新增好友通知 4、微信删除好友通知 5、微信好友发来信息通知 6、回复微信好友聊天消息 7、聊天执行结果通知 8、获取微信通讯录好友列表...9、获取群列表 10、好友请求添加好友的通知 11、获取手机客户端上微信的二维码 ...这些API可开发群控、云控、微信客服系统等系列微信营销软件!...关注指定公众号 ...这些API可辅助开发群控、云控、营销手机、微信客服系统等系列微信营销软件!

    4.3K110

    在线客服技术详解(未完待续)

    通知解决方案 在线客服系统最重要的就是通知,用户发送的消息如何通知到客服客服发送的消息又如果通知到用户,下面讲解其中一些常用的通知解决方案。...这个,我们在用户登陆,负载均衡服务器给其分配到某个特定的服务器的时候,就可以这个特定服务器的IP记录下来,客服就可以往这台机器发消息了,而用户也同样可以从该IP获取数据了。...路由分配 现在来讲一个路由分配,这个应该从什么时候进行路由分配,如何进行路由分配,分配失败了怎么办等方面来讨论。 1、什么时候进行路由分配 什么时候进行路由分配呢?...但不管怎么说,一般都是客服划分为不同的技能,一个客服可能拥有一个或者多个技能,用户登陆的时候,属于一种技能,路由分配的时候根据该路由策略将用户分配到对应的客服。...来话转接到另外一个客服,另外一个客服如果需要辨认出该来话是转接的话,则需要有所标识,比如说,在来话转接的时候,模拟用户给客服消息消息,里面注明是来话转移,从那个客服转移过来的;另外,呼叫转接的时候,也可以是客服直接给另一个客服一条提示

    1.6K50

    得物从0到1自研客服IM系统的技术实践之路

    本篇文章基于工程实践,分享我们从0到1自研一套客服IM系统时在各种关键技术点上的设计思路和实践方法。 图片 注:为了简化内容,本文分享的技术栈主要是以Web客服端为主。...如果IM的SDK设计不合理,发送消息和接收消息流程出现了卡顿,直接影响用户的体验。...2)Login: 登录,token验证,获取或创建当前用户topic信息; 3)Sub: 订阅topic或更新topic数据; 4)Leave: 取消订阅,解绑之前的订阅关系; 5)Pub: 发送数据消息指定...其实现大致如下: 图片 图片 7.5.1消息链路分析 针对客服发送消息,我们首先要站在客服角度考虑消息是否已发出去,优先展示的聊天页面,而不是等网关给了回复后在展示到聊天页面。...ID生成器(Tinyid)》 7.5.3.2)ACK机制中的消息重试: 消息推给A的过程中丢失了怎么办,比如: 1)A网络实际已经不可达,但IM网关还没有感知到(ping出现问题); 2)消息在中间网络途中被某些中间设备丢掉了

    82030

    2016,APP开发者必须关注的新技术

    4.0版本中新增工单中心和APP工作台,客服装进口袋、让全公司都参与到客服的协同处理。...同时对3.0版本的核心功能进行了优化升级:全面优化了语义分析算法,客服机器人的回答准确率提升至97%;全新的统计系统丰富了大数据统计内容,并且智齿实时数据查询和展现,帮助企业全面掌握客服数据,完善客服考核...4.诸葛io 诸葛io在15年底推出了“无码布点SDK”——由诸葛io提供的一款零代码、可视化、无需二次版的事件管理平台。...通过诸葛io提供的无码SDK,开发者只需在首次版时接入一行统计代码,就可以实现动态的事件跟踪。...同时,在服务的稳定性方面,融云有经过亿级用户验证的即时通讯平台架构,在稳定性、运维经验方面有8年亿级用户稳定运维经验,从而确保消息不丢、不重、不乱序。

    1.1K100

    开源免费在线客服系统-真正免费开源-GOFLY0.3.5布-极简强大Go语言开发WEB网页客服

    极简强大Go语言开发在线客服GOFLY0.3.5布 更新日志: ##### V0.3.5 新增分开系统自动断线与客服关闭连接 修复没有设置欢迎时tip显示错误问题 修复客服端发送消息错误提示不显示问题...修复一些界面问题 修复死锁问题 ##### V0.3.3 1.访客/客服端聊天界面样式修改 2.访客端展示客服头像信息 3.访客到来自动打开,以及参数控制 4.访客/客服端聊天信息默认折叠 5.客服端新消息提醒标识...6.客服端访客列表展示访客正在输入信息 ##### V0.3.2 1.修改访客界面样式,更加简洁扁平 2.修改自动欢迎界面样式增加聊天框效果 3.修改数据库时间字段类型,兼容mysql5.7...修改数据库时间字段类型,兼容mysql5.5+ ##### V0.2.9 1.访客开多个窗口时 , 单点登录关闭旧ws连接 2.访客切换窗口时可以自动重连 3.访客到来时 , http接口和ws接口同时发送给客服上线信息...4.客服后台定时拉取在线访客接口 5.客服后台切换tab拉取在线访客 下载地址: https://gitee.com/taoshihan/go-fly/releases 开源地址: https:/

    1.8K10

    网站在线客服系统源码 | 全渠道在线客服代码下载 (最新版支持外贸商城H5小程序公众号对接)

    什么是在线客服系统? 在线客服系统是通过独立应用程序或嵌入式脚本代码进行的实时即时通讯消息交换。...随着时代的发展,越来越多的企业网站或者商城网站网页开始对接在线客服系统。 在线客服系统与电子邮件的不同之处在于消息交换的即时性。还有就是在线客服旨在模仿面对面的对话,所以个人消息通常很简短。...近年来市面上出现了越来越多的在线客服系统,还不断有新的在线客服企业加入,这让刚接触在线客服系统的人挑得眼花缭乱,那到底应该怎么选择一个适合企业使用的在线客服系统呢,我先给大家介绍下在线客服发展的历史,然后介绍下客服系统都有哪些功能...随着互联网的发展,出现了第一批在线客服系统,这类系统被定义为是一种网页版即时通讯软件,只需向页面插入一小段代码,它就能够运行在网站上,网站访客无需安装任何软件点击指定按钮即可通过网页进行对话,后来出现了如...;还有其它一些功能,比如说智能机器人、客服转接、流量分析、工单系统等等   ● 图片传输:许多客户端允许用户在消息中插入图像和表情符号。

    82420

    58到家通用实时消息平台架构细节(Qcon2016)

    传统方案往往可以通过结合【端到云】与【云到端】来结合解决【端到端】的实时消息推送问题。 三、通用实时消息平台实现细节 业务的分析与抽象:司机、用户、商家、客服均为“在线”业务 【端到云的优化】 ?...如上图(本文最重要的2张图之一),整个消息投递流程为: (1)发送消息发给消息平台 (2)消息平台先将消息落地DB (3)消息平台回复发送方消息发送成功(此时和接收方是否接到无关) (3)与此同时,...并行的把消息投递给接收方(如果不在线就存离线了) (4)接收方应用层ACK表示收到了消息 (5)消息平台消息删除 (6)告之接收方ACK已经成功处理 可以看到,是使用“应用层ACK来解决消息可达性问题的...” 潜在问题:发送方没有收到第3步骤中的消息平台回复怎么办?...接入(如果在线) (5)DB,存储离线消息消息平台的几个业务部分: (1)APP:业务方APP,可以有多个,通过msg-sdk来接入消息平台 (2)mq:消息平台通过mq来给业务方服务器“端到云”

    1.9K50
    领券